Premier League chief Masters reveals deadline for free agent extensions

Premier League chief Richard Masters says clubs will have until June 23 to extend the contracts of their upcoming free agents.

Players who have expiring deals will be able to negotiate a short extension with clubs so they can complete the 2019/20 season, which is expected to continue into July.

"What we decided today - obviously this issue has been highlighted and we've discussed it at the last two meetings - but we've been working as far as possible to ensure that clubs complete the season with the same squad they had prior to the suspension," Masters said.

"What was agreed today is that players can extend their contracts beyond June 30 until the end of the season but it must be agreed by both parties and a later date can be scheduled for that; no later than June 23."
